One of the primary steps to enhancing your complexion is washing your face thoroughly 2 to 3 times a day. Wash your hands with an anti bacterial soap and, utilizing a mild bar soap or acne scrub, thoroughly wash your face for about thirty seconds. Verify that your bar soap is fragrance and color free as these can clog your pores and irritate your skin, bringing on inflammation and expanded redness of your face.

In the event that washing your face is insufficient, more measures could be taken for acne home treatment. One amongst the most well-known is the utilization of benzoyl peroxide, which might be found in face wash, bar soap, topical cream or gel. Benzoyl peroxide is commonly utilized once or twice daily, but at first most individuals ought to solely apply it once a day or every other day to avoid redness and excessive drying. For the most part, results will be apparent after a few weeks, however in the event that you don't notice a difference by then you ought to consult your dermatologist for recommendation.

Another popular acne home treatment is salicylic acid. You can typically notice this in medicated facial pads and furthermore in some face washes. Salicylic acid prevents your hair follicles from shedding excess skin and clogging your pores, thereby fighting the reason behind most acne and blackheads.

Whichever home treatment you believe to be best for your acne, always remember that the results are gradual and can be perceptible in a couple weeks. Follow the directions for your product and solely utilize it the specified number of times per day. Also, combining treatments at the same time may cause irritation and excessive dryness to your face, so salicylic acid and benzoyl peroxide ought to solely be utilized one at a time. In the event that you don't notice results for your acne home treatment after several weeks, contact your doctor for further advice.

Acne And Diet - Insulin Resistance, And Hormones

Diet, though not an immediate reason for acne, does have an indirect result on acne. That's why such a large number of ‘acne cures’ prescribe dietary changes in conjunction with whatever else they're advocating.

Because diet has an indirect result on acne, people can get variable effects when changing what they consume. This's often as a result of we all metabolize foods otherwise. Some individuals may be more sensitive to specific nourishments, and so those foods can have a larger effect on their acne than others that don’t have those metabolic problems.

Case in point, skin with a tendency for acne has been demonstrated to be insulin resistant. Insulin is a hormone that regulates carbohydrate metabolism, and also assuming a part in protein metabolism and fat metabolism. Insulin regulates the way our cells use the accessible energy in the circulation system, so insulin makes the liver and fat cells (adipose tissue) take in some of the glucose in the circulation system and stores it as fat.

Acne And Diet - Insulin Resistance, And Hormones
Individuals with insulin resistance don’t react to the normal measures of insulin released in the body. As a result of the regulation of blood glucose levels (which insulin ultimately is in charge of) is so vital, the pancreas begins delivering more insulin once the liver and fat cells don’t react. Blood glucose levels can build up if the body still doesn’t respond.

High levels of insulin can result in hypertension, fluid retention, and might cause type two diabetes.

Thus, for those with insulin resistance, poor quality carbohydrates like sugar, white bread and sugary foods, may be an issue. These sorts of carbohydrates are digested rapidly and enter the circulatory system quickly. Ordinarily, insulin would trigger the body removing those overabundance blood sugars into cells. Anyway with insulin resistance, they hang around longer in the blood, and also causing the body to have high levels of insulin in the blood.

This is essential for acne sufferers, especially women, in that abundance insulin can result in elevated levels of male hormones. These androgen hormones have long been implicated in acne. They expand the oil generation of the sebaceous glands, which ends up in clogged pores and gives a breeding ground for the acne bacteria.

In another study, analysts implicate the high levels of refined carbohydrates (for example, cereals and bread) in teenage acne. Following the same principle, they propose that high levels of blood sugars increase the levels of insulin and insulin-like growth factor (IGF-1), which ends up in overabundance generation of male hormones. These male hormones then trigger acne episodes.

What's more and in addition that, insulin-like growth element (IGF-1) encourages certain skin cells (keratinocytes) to increase. Keratinocytes are also implicated in acne.

Acne Treatment : Treat Acne With Essential Fatty Acids

Whilst scientists don't completely comprehend the reason for acne, the role of essential fatty acids in the body, including the skin, is reasonably understood. This comprehension has led to some researchers and natural health practitioners looking at the benefits and impacts of essential fatty acids for skin conditions like acne.

Acne Treatment : Treat Acne With Essential Fatty AcidsUdo Erasmus is a writer with post graduate studies in genetics, and biochemistry, and a PhD in Nutrition. He accepts there are nutritional deficiencies and issues that may result in or worsen acne, though they are not as simple as the ordinary ones about chocolate!

Key to his conviction is that: (Hard fats and (hard) protein debris clog narrow pores and channels in our skin, and invite infection by bacteria who feast on the mess). (p346)
He accepts acne is because “fatty degeneration”.

Factors in this are:

* too much -hard- fats

* fats associating poorly with protein

* insufficient essential fatty acids

Hard fats are additionally known as saturated fatty acids. These are the fats that are found in most nourishment, including dairy and animal fats. Their name originates from the way that the fat molecules carry the maximum quantity of hydrogen molecules that they perhaps can. This has significance in the fact these fats act in our body. A number of these saturated fats have a high melting point, such as milk fat and butter.

An overabundance can result in issues for our arteries and heart health.

Fatty acids, of the essential and non essential kind, are found in our cell membranes. This incorporates the membranes of the skin. Erasmus describes the characteristics of saturated fatty acids as having a tendency to stick together. Furthermore, in light of the fact that they have a higher melting point, they are more probably to be clump together and form deposits when we consume them in overabundance. So, they're harder for the body to get rid of. And as well as clumping together, they can clump with other things such as minerals, protein and cholesterol. Abundance sugar could be an issue as a result of our body converts excess sugar into saturated fatty acids.

Other issues with excess saturated fatty acids incorporates the way that the body can change over them into unsaturated fatty acids, which might then oxidize if we tend don’t consume enough fatty acids.

Saturated fatty acids can diminish the supply of oxygen to our tissues, by creating blood cells that carry oxygen stick together, and so impede that important transportation system which commonly carries oxygen to our cells.

Abundance fat, incorporating excess saturated fats, are stored in the adipose cells in our skin. These are fat storage centers.

Erasmus proposes consuming W3 -alpha linolenic acid- and w6 -flax and linoleic acid- essential fatty acids in the right ratio.

Essential fatty acids have free receptors for hydrogen bonds. This characteristic changes the manner the molecules are organized regarding the shape they have. What's more, it's this different shape, a kinked shape, meaning they don’t clump together with the affinity that saturated fats do. Furthermore, they likewise have a lower melting point, so they are more fluid conjointly. Due to this distinction in structure, they additionally have a slight negative molecular charge, and given that like charges repel, this is one more reason why they don’t clump together. Erasmus describes these properties of unsaturated fats as giving ‘fluidity’ to cell membranes. He says this permits the cells to fulfill vital chemical functions.

Inflammation, a characteristic of acne, is connected with a deficiency in the essential fatty acid LNA, or alpha linolenic acid. Erasmus writes that whilst inflammation isn't a classical symptom of LNA, once individuals take alpha linolenic acid supplements, this side effect might be reversed.

Essential fatty acids as a group are powerfully anti-inflammatory. An alternate essential fatty acid, linoleic acid (LA) has specific reference to acne. At the point when there is an insufficiency of linoleic acid, the oil creating glands in the skin make sebum that's mixed with oleic acid. Oleic acid is found in land animal fats and butter. But, in overabundance, it can interfere in essential fatty acid utilization. However, more imperatively for acne sufferers, sebum mixed with oleic acid is irritating to the skin. It lends itself to blockages of the pores that bring about acne, whiteheads and blackheads.
